    @chill-dad 227262 wrote:

    That’s at least half my riding..

    Is there a leaderboard for the kids this year?

    There is! It looks like it still works from previous years if you scroll down the “pointless” data tracking tab.
    As of post-bedtime 1/2/24 there are 3 kids currently in the competition for riding under their own power:
    https://freezingsaddles.org/pointless/pointlesskids

    2 adults riding with kids:
    https://freezingsaddles.org/pointless/hashtag/withkid

    I don’t think anyone’s tagged a #kidical ride transporting kids on their bike yet, but I think they should show up here:
    https://freezingsaddles.org/pointless/kidmiles

    One key part of taking a kid somewhere and dropping them off is remembering to stop the Strava to tag them on their part of the ride and then *restart* it again to capture the rest of your ride. Nothing like riding a bunch of miles and realizing that you forgot to hit start again.
